People across the UK will turn off their lights from 10pm to 11pm on Monday, August 4 to mark the time that Great Britain entered the war.

Centenary candles, organised by the Royal British Legion, are available in M&S.

Sandy RBL is planning a commemorative vigil at the Bedford Road war memorial during the hour. Nearby street lights will be turned off.
